Rotor System



The rotor system, a vital element in helicopter layout, plays an essential role in providing lift and directional control during trip. Consisting of the main rotor and tail blades, this system is liable for creating the required wind resistant pressures to keep the helicopter airborne and manoeuvrable.


Additionally, the primary rotor also permits the helicopter to move in different instructions by tilting the blades disc. By altering the angle of the rotor blades jointly, pilots can manage the helicopter's forward, backward, and sidewards activities. In contrast, the tail rotor, placed at the tail end of the helicopter, combats the torque produced by the primary rotor's turning, making certain the helicopter stays well balanced and can make regulated turns. Together, these rotor components develop an innovative system that allows helicopters to carry out a wide array of trip maneuvers efficiently and securely.

Transmission System





An integral element of the UH60 helicopter's capability and performance is its transmission system. The transmission system in a UH60 helicopter is liable for transferring power from the engines to the major blades and tail blades systems. This important element guarantees that the helicopter can maneuver effectively and preserve stability during trip procedures.


The transmission system in the UH60 helicopter contains various components, consisting of the main transmission, intermediate gearbox, tail transmission, and drive shafts. Each of these components plays an important function in making sure that power is dispersed properly throughout the airplane.


The major gearbox is specifically vital as it moves power from the engines to the main rotor system, enabling the helicopter to raise off the ground and achieve onward, backward, and side motion. The tail transmission, on the various other hand, transfers power to the tail blades, which assists neutralize the primary blades's torque and offers directional control.

The landing equipment of the UH60 helicopter serves as a vital component for ensuring safe and steady ground operations, complementing the functionality of its transmission system. Including wheels, shock absorbers, and assistance structures, the landing gear sustains the helicopter's weight throughout departure, landing, and while you can check here on the ground. The design of the landing equipment is vital for dispersing the airplane's weight evenly to avoid tipping or architectural damages. Additionally, the touchdown equipment plays an important duty in taking in the effect of touchdowns, decreasing the anxiety on the airframe and guaranteeing a smooth touchdown. Proper maintenance of the landing equipment is important to assure ideal performance and security during procedures. Routine inspections, lubrication, and replacement of damaged elements are required to support the dependability and effectiveness of the touchdown equipment system.
